If approved, danuglipron could be an additional option for people living with type 2 diabetes and obesity. Pfizer is moving forward with the clinical development of a new oral GLP-1 medicine called danuglipron for obesity and type 2 diabetes. Pfizer plans to further evaluate the safety and efficacy of the drug in clinical trials.
By Arvind Sommi Verified| diaTribe Verified Diabetic retinopathy is often preventable if caught early. Advancements in artificial intelligence and eye-scanning technology have made it possible for more people with diabetes to get evaluated for diabetic retinopathy. One in three people with diabetes has diabetic retinopathy, making it one of the most common diabetes complications. “It steals their joy, it steals their autonomy, and it deserves a solution,” said Dr. Robert Levine, chairman of the Mary Tyler Moore Vision Initiative.

diaTribe
The diaTribe Foundation is a non-profit organization based in San Francisco, California, focused on improving the lives of individuals affected by diabetes and prediabetes. Founded by Kelly Close, the foundation aims to provide education, advocacy, and convening opportunities to help people manage their conditions effectively. The foundation offers free online educational resources through diaTribe Learn, which provides management tips and insights into the latest research and treatments. It also advocates for policy changes to enhance access to therapies and technologies, amplifying the voices of those with diabetes. Additionally, the diaTribe Foundation convenes stakeholders to address diabetes-related issues, including initiatives like The Time in Range Coalition and the dStigmatize program to combat stigma associated with diabetes. Led by CEO Jim Carroll, the diaTribe Foundation reaches over 6 million people annually, including individuals with diabetes, healthcare professionals, and policymakers. The organization emphasizes transparency and accountability in its operations.
